499 строки
14 KiB
JSON
499 строки
14 KiB
JSON
{
|
|
"tagVariables": {
|
|
"nanoServerVersion": "10.0.14393.1715"
|
|
},
|
|
"testCommands": {
|
|
"linux": [
|
|
"docker build --rm -t testrunner -f ./test/Dockerfile.linux.testrunner .",
|
|
"docker run -v /var/run/docker.sock:/var/run/docker.sock testrunner powershell -File ./test/run-test.ps1 -Filter $(Filter) -Architecture $(Architecture)"
|
|
],
|
|
"windows": [
|
|
"powershell -NoProfile -Command .\\test\\run-test.ps1 -Filter $(Filter)"
|
|
]
|
|
},
|
|
"repos": [
|
|
{
|
|
"name": "microsoft/dotnet-nightly",
|
|
"readmePath": "README.md",
|
|
"images": [
|
|
{
|
|
"readmeOrder": 1,
|
|
"sharedTags": {
|
|
"1.0.7-runtime-deps": {},
|
|
"1.0-runtime-deps": {},
|
|
"1-runtime-deps": {},
|
|
"1.1-runtime-deps": {
|
|
"isUndocumented": true
|
|
}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"1.0/runtime-deps/jessie",
|
|
"os": "linux",
|
|
"tags": {
|
|
"1.0.7-runtime-deps-jessie": {},
|
|
"1.0-core-deps": {
|
|
"isUndocumented": true
|
|
},
|
|
"1-core-deps": {
|
|
"isUndocumented": true
|
|
},
|
|
"core-deps":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 0,
|
|
"sharedTags": {
|
|
"1.0.7-runtime": {},
|
|
"1.0-runtime":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"1.0/runtime/jessie",
|
|
"os": "linux",
|
|
"tags": {
|
|
"1.0.7-runtime-jessie": {},
|
|
"1.0-core":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"dockerfile": "1.0/runtime/nanoserver",
|
|
"os": "windows",
|
|
"tags": {
|
|
"1.0.7-runtime-nanoserver": {},
|
|
"1.0.7-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.0-run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.0-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 2,
|
|
"sharedTags": {
|
|
"1.1.4-runtime": {},
|
|
"1.1-runtime": {},
|
|
"1-runtime":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"1.1/runtime/jessie",
|
|
"os": "linux",
|
|
"tags": {
|
|
"1.1.4-runtime-jessie": {},
|
|
"1-core": {
|
|
"isUndocumented": true
|
|
},
|
|
"core":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
},
|
|
{
|
|
"dockerfile": "1.1/runtime/nanoserver",
|
|
"os": "windows",
|
|
"tags": {
|
|
"1.1.4-runtime-nanoserver": {},
|
|
"1.1.4-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.1-run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.1-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"1-run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"1-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 3,
|
|
"sharedTags": {
|
|
"1.1.4-sdk": {},
|
|
"1.1-sdk": {},
|
|
"1-sdk": {},
|
|
"1.0-sdk": {
|
|
"isUndocumented": true
|
|
}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"1.1/sdk/jessie",
|
|
"os": "linux",
|
|
"tags": {
|
|
"1.1.4-sdk-jessie": {}
|
|
}
|
|
},
|
|
{
|
|
"dockerfile": "1.1/sdk/nanoserver",
|
|
"os": "windows",
|
|
"tags": {
|
|
"1.1.4-sdk-nanoserver": {},
|
|
"1.1.4-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.1-sdk-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"1.1-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"1-sdk-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"1-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"sdk-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 6,
|
|
"sharedTags": {
|
|
"2.0.1-runtime-deps": {},
|
|
"2.0-runtime-deps": {},
|
|
"2-runtime-deps": {},
|
|
"runtime-deps":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/runtime-deps/stretch/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-deps-stretch": {}
|
|
}
|
|
},
|
|
{
|
|
"architecture": "arm",
|
|
"dockerfile": "2.0/runtime-deps/stretch/arm32v7",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-deps-stretch-arm32v7": {},
|
|
"2.0-runtime-deps-stretch-arm32v7":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-runtime-deps-stretch-arm32v7": {
|
|
"isUndocumented": true
|
|
}
|
|
},
|
|
"variant": "armv7"
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 4,
|
|
"sharedTags": {
|
|
"2.0.1-runtime": {},
|
|
"2.0-runtime": {},
|
|
"2-runtime": {},
|
|
"runtime":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/runtime/stretch/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-stretch": {}
|
|
}
|
|
},
|
|
{
|
|
"architecture": "arm",
|
|
"dockerfile": "2.0/runtime/stretch/arm32v7",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-stretch-arm32v7": {},
|
|
"2.0-runtime-stretch-arm32v7":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-runtime-stretch-arm32v7": {
|
|
"isUndocumented": true
|
|
}
|
|
},
|
|
"variant": "armv7"
|
|
},
|
|
{
|
|
"dockerfile": "2.0/runtime/nanoserver/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.0.1-runtime-nanoserver": {},
|
|
"2.0.1-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"2.0-run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"2.0-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-runtime-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 8,
|
|
"sharedTags": {
|
|
"2.0.1-sdk-2.0.3": {},
|
|
"2.0-sdk": {},
|
|
"2-sdk": {},
|
|
"sdk": {},
|
|
"latest":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/sdk/stretch/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-sdk-2.0.3-stretch": {}
|
|
}
|
|
},
|
|
{
|
|
"dockerfile": "2.0/sdk/nanoserver/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.0.1-sdk-2.0.3-nanoserver": {},
|
|
"2.0.1-sdk-2.0.3-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"2.0-sdk-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"2.0-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-sdk-nanoserver": {
|
|
"isUndocumented": true
|
|
},
|
|
"2-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 7,
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/runtime-deps/jessie/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-deps-jessie": {},
|
|
"2.0-runtime-deps-jessie": {},
|
|
"2-runtime-deps-jessie": {}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 5,
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/runtime/jessie/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-runtime-jessie": {},
|
|
"2.0-runtime-jessie": {},
|
|
"2-runtime-jessie": {}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 9,
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/sdk/jessie/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.0.1-sdk-2.0.3-jessie": {},
|
|
"2.0-sdk-jessie": {},
|
|
"2-sdk-jessie": {}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 10,
|
|
"sharedTags": {
|
|
"2.1.0-preview1-runtime": {},
|
|
"2.1-runtime":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.1/runtime/stretch/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.1.0-preview1-runtime-stretch": {}
|
|
}
|
|
},
|
|
{
|
|
"architecture": "arm",
|
|
"dockerfile": "2.1/runtime/stretch/arm32v7",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.1.0-preview1-runtime-stretch-arm32v7": {},
|
|
"2.1-runtime-stretch-arm32v7": {
|
|
"isUndocumented": true
|
|
}
|
|
},
|
|
"variant": "armv7"
|
|
},
|
|
{
|
|
"dockerfile": "2.1/runtime/nanoserver/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.1.0-preview1-runtime-nanoserver": {},
|
|
"2.1.0-preview1-runtime-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 12,
|
|
"sharedTags": {
|
|
"2.1.0-preview1-sdk": {},
|
|
"2.1-sdk":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.1/sdk/stretch/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.1.0-preview1-sdk-stretch": {}
|
|
}
|
|
},
|
|
{
|
|
"dockerfile": "2.1/sdk/nanoserver/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.1.0-preview1-sdk-nanoserver": {},
|
|
"2.1.0-preview1-sdk-nanoserver-$(nanoServerVersion)":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 11,
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.1/runtime/jessie/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.1.0-preview1-runtime-jessie": {},
|
|
"2.1-runtime-jessie": {}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"readmeOrder": 13,
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.1/sdk/jessie/amd64",
|
|
"os": "linux",
|
|
"tags": {
|
|
"2.1.0-preview1-sdk-jessie": {},
|
|
"2.1-sdk-jessie": {}
|
|
}
|
|
}
|
|
]
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"name": "microsoft/nanoserver-insider-dotnet",
|
|
"readmePath": "2.0/runtime/nanoserver-insider/README.md",
|
|
"images": [
|
|
{
|
|
"sharedTags": {
|
|
"2.0.1-runtime": {},
|
|
"2.0-runtime": {},
|
|
"2-runtime": {},
|
|
"runtime":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/runtime/nanoserver-insider/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.0.1-runtime-nanoserver": {},
|
|
"2.0.1-runtime-nanoserver-10.0.16267.1001":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
},
|
|
{
|
|
"sharedTags": {
|
|
"2.0.1-sdk": {},
|
|
"2.0-sdk": {},
|
|
"2-sdk": {},
|
|
"sdk": {},
|
|
"latest": {}
|
|
},
|
|
"platforms": [
|
|
{
|
|
"dockerfile": "2.0/sdk/nanoserver-insider/amd64",
|
|
"os": "windows",
|
|
"tags": {
|
|
"2.0.1-sdk-nanoserver": {},
|
|
"2.0.1-sdk-nanoserver-10.0.16267.1001": {
|
|
"isUndocumented": true
|
|
}
|
|
}
|
|
}
|
|
]
|
|
}
|
|
]
|
|
}
|
|
]
|
|
} |